关系型数据库的使用场景有哪些?发掘不同领域的潜在价值。

阅读人数:538预计阅读时长:6 min

关系型数据库在现代企业的数据处理和管理中扮演着不可或缺的角色,无论是在传统行业还是在新兴领域,关系型数据库都展示了其强大的适应性和价值。随着数据量级的不断增长和业务需求的复杂化,如何高效利用关系型数据库,发掘其在不同领域的潜在价值,成为企业数字化转型的关键之一。

关系型数据库的使用场景有哪些?发掘不同领域的潜在价值。

在这个信息爆炸的时代,企业每天都在产生和处理海量的数据。然而,面对如此庞大的数据量,传统数据管理方式显得力不从心,这也是为何关系型数据库的重要性日益凸显的原因之一。其提供了结构化存储和高效查询的能力,使企业能够从数据中提取有价值的洞见,优化决策流程,并提升竞争力。

关系型数据库的使用场景广泛且多样。无论是金融、医疗、零售,还是物流、教育、制造业等各个领域,关系型数据库都凭借其强大的数据管理和处理能力,为企业创造了巨大的价值。例如,在金融行业中,关系型数据库用于管理客户信息、交易记录和风险控制;在医疗行业中,它用于存储并分析患者数据、医疗记录和研究资料。这些应用场景都不仅体现了关系型数据库的基本功能,更展示了其在各行业中深度结合业务需求的能力。

企业在选择和使用关系型数据库时,也面临着一系列挑战,如数据安全性、系统扩展性、实时性需求等。特别是在大数据时代,如何实现高性能的数据同步和集成是一个常见的技术难题。FineDataLink作为一款国产的、高效实用的低代码ETL工具,提供了企业级一站式数据集成平台的解决方案。它支持对数据源进行单表、多表、整库、多对一数据的实时全量和增量同步,帮助企业在大数据场景下实现高效的数据采集、集成和管理。

关系型数据库的使用场景不仅限于传统的业务操作,它还在不断拓展新的应用领域。通过深入分析和探讨,我们可以更好地理解关系型数据库的潜在价值,为企业在数字化转型过程中提供更多的可能性和选择。

🏦 一、金融行业中的关系型数据库

1. 客户信息管理

在金融行业中,客户信息是企业最为重要的资产之一。关系型数据库在客户信息管理中展现了强大的数据处理和查询能力。金融机构每天都需要处理大量的客户数据,包括基本信息、账户信息、交易记录等。通过关系型数据库,金融机构可以实现对这些信息的高效管理和快速查询。

关系型数据库的结构化数据存储方式,使得金融机构能够对数据进行精细化的分类和管理。这不仅提升了数据的可读性和可用性,还使得数据分析和挖掘更加便捷。例如,通过SQL查询,金融机构可以快速筛选出特定条件下的客户信息,进行精准的客户画像分析。

此外,关系型数据库支持事务管理,确保数据的一致性和完整性。这对于金融行业尤为重要,因为金融交易的每一个步骤都需要确保数据的精确无误。关系型数据库通过ACID特性(Atomicity, Consistency, Isolation, Durability),保证了数据操作的原子性、一致性、隔离性和持久性,从而提升了金融系统的安全性和可靠性。

优势 具体表现 应用效果
数据结构化 提供表格化的数据存储 提高数据管理效率
支持事务管理 确保数据一致性和完整性 增强数据安全性
高效查询 支持复杂SQL查询 提升数据分析能力
  • 促进精准客户画像分析
  • 改善客户服务体验
  • 提升市场营销策略的有效性

2. 风险控制与合规

金融行业面临的另一个重要挑战是风险控制和合规性。关系型数据库在这方面也发挥了重要作用。金融机构需要遵循严格的监管要求,确保业务操作的合规性和透明性。通过关系型数据库,金融机构可以实现对风险因素的全面监控和评估。

关系型数据库可以存储大量的历史交易数据和风险评估模型,为风险控制提供数据支持。例如,通过对历史数据的分析,金融机构可以识别出潜在的风险因素,并制定相应的风险管理策略。此外,关系型数据库的日志功能可以记录所有数据操作,帮助金融机构进行审计和合规检查。

在风险控制方面,关系型数据库还可以与其他数据分析工具结合使用,进行更深入的风险分析和预测。例如,通过与FineDataLink的结合,金融机构可以实现对多源数据的实时同步和分析,提升风险控制的时效性和准确性。

  • 提供数据支持,识别风险因素
  • 记录数据操作,支持审计检查
  • 与数据分析工具结合,提升风险分析准确性

关系型数据库在金融行业中不仅仅是一个数据存储工具,更是企业进行数据驱动决策的重要支撑。通过有效的客户信息管理和风险控制,金融机构可以提高业务运营效率,增强市场竞争力。

🏥 二、医疗行业中的关系型数据库

1. 患者数据管理

在医疗行业中,患者数据管理是关系型数据库应用最为广泛的场景之一。医疗机构每天都在产生和处理大量的患者数据,包括病历、检查结果、治疗方案等。这些数据的管理和分析对于提升医疗服务质量和患者体验具有重要意义。

关系型数据库通过提供结构化的数据存储和高效的查询能力,为医疗机构的患者数据管理提供了有力支持。通过关系型数据库,医疗机构可以实现对患者数据的精细化管理和快速访问。例如,医护人员可以通过简单的SQL查询,快速获取患者的历史病历和治疗记录,从而制定更为精准的治疗方案。

此外,关系型数据库的事务管理功能确保了患者数据的一致性和完整性。这对于医疗行业尤为重要,因为任何数据的错误或丢失都可能对患者的健康造成严重影响。关系型数据库通过ACID特性,保证了患者数据的安全和可靠。

优势 具体表现 应用效果
数据结构化 提供表格化的数据存储 提高数据管理效率
支持事务管理 确保数据一致性和完整性 增强数据安全性
高效查询 支持复杂SQL查询 提升数据分析能力
  • 提升医疗服务质量
  • 改善患者体验
  • 提高医疗决策的准确性

2. 医疗研究与数据分析

除了患者数据管理,关系型数据库在医疗研究和数据分析中也扮演着重要角色。医疗研究需要处理大量的实验数据和研究结果,这些数据的分析和挖掘对于推动医疗科技的进步具有重要作用。

关系型数据库通过提供高效的数据存储和查询能力,支持医疗研究人员对数据进行深入分析。例如,通过对临床试验数据的分析,研究人员可以发现新的医学模式和治疗方法。此外,关系型数据库还可以与大数据分析工具结合使用,进行更为复杂的数据挖掘和预测分析。

在数据分析方面,关系型数据库可以帮助医疗机构发现潜在的健康风险和疾病趋势。例如,通过对大规模患者数据的分析,医疗机构可以识别出特定疾病的高风险人群,并制定相应的预防措施。这不仅有助于提升公共卫生水平,还有助于降低医疗成本。

  • 支持深入数据分析,推动医学研究
  • 发现健康风险,提升公共卫生水平
  • 结合大数据工具,进行复杂数据挖掘

关系型数据库在医疗行业中的应用,不仅提升了患者数据管理的效率,还推动了医疗研究和数据分析的进步。通过有效的数据管理和分析,医疗机构可以提供更高质量的医疗服务,推动医疗科技的创新发展。

🛒 三、零售行业中的关系型数据库

1. 库存管理与优化

在零售行业中,库存管理是企业经营的重要环节。关系型数据库通过提供结构化的数据存储和高效的查询能力,为零售企业的库存管理提供了支持。零售企业可以通过关系型数据库,实现对库存数据的精细化管理和快速访问,从而优化库存水平,减少库存成本。

关系型数据库支持对商品信息、库存数量、销售记录等数据的存储和管理。通过SQL查询,零售企业可以快速获取商品的库存信息和销售数据,进行库存分析和预测。例如,通过对历史销售数据的分析,零售企业可以预测商品的需求趋势,制定合理的采购计划,避免库存过多或断货。

此外,关系型数据库的事务管理功能确保了库存数据的一致性和完整性。这对于零售行业尤为重要,因为库存数据的错误可能导致企业的运营风险和成本增加。关系型数据库通过ACID特性,保证了库存数据的安全和可靠。

优势 具体表现 应用效果
数据结构化 提供表格化的数据存储 提高数据管理效率
支持事务管理 确保数据一致性和完整性 增强数据安全性
高效查询 支持复杂SQL查询 提升数据分析能力
  • 优化库存水平,减少库存成本
  • 提升库存管理效率
  • 提高采购计划的准确性

2. 客户关系管理与营销策略

在零售行业中,客户关系管理和营销策略是提升企业竞争力的重要因素。关系型数据库通过提供高效的数据存储和查询能力,支持零售企业对客户数据的管理和分析。例如,通过对客户购买记录的分析,零售企业可以了解客户的购买偏好和消费习惯,从而制定个性化的营销策略。

bi数据可视化系统

关系型数据库支持对客户信息、购买记录、反馈意见等数据的存储和管理。通过SQL查询,零售企业可以快速获取客户的历史购买记录和反馈信息,进行客户画像分析和精准营销。例如,通过对客户的购买历史进行分析,零售企业可以制定个性化的促销活动,提高客户满意度和忠诚度。

在营销策略方面,关系型数据库还可以与其他数据分析工具结合使用,进行更为深入的市场分析和预测。例如,通过与FineDataLink的结合,零售企业可以实现对多源数据的实时同步和分析,提升营销策略的精准性和时效性。

  • 提供数据支持,了解客户偏好
  • 制定个性化营销策略,提高客户满意度
  • 结合数据分析工具,提升市场分析准确性

关系型数据库在零售行业中的应用,不仅提升了库存管理的效率,还支持了客户关系管理和营销策略的制定。通过有效的数据管理和分析,零售企业可以提高业务运营效率,增强市场竞争力。

⚙️ 四、制造业中的关系型数据库

1. 生产流程管理

在制造业中,生产流程管理是企业运营的核心环节。关系型数据库通过提供结构化的数据存储和高效的查询能力,为制造企业的生产流程管理提供了支持。制造企业可以通过关系型数据库,实现对生产数据的精细化管理和快速访问,从而优化生产流程,提升生产效率。

关系型数据库支持对生产计划、工艺流程、设备状态等数据的存储和管理。通过SQL查询,制造企业可以快速获取生产计划和设备状态,进行生产流程分析和优化。例如,通过对生产数据的分析,制造企业可以识别出生产瓶颈,制定改进措施,提升生产效率。

此外,关系型数据库的事务管理功能确保了生产数据的一致性和完整性。这对于制造业尤为重要,因为生产数据的错误可能导致产品质量问题和生产成本增加。关系型数据库通过ACID特性,保证了生产数据的安全和可靠。

优势 具体表现 应用效果
数据结构化 提供表格化的数据存储 提高数据管理效率
支持事务管理 确保数据一致性和完整性 增强数据安全性
高效查询 支持复杂SQL查询 提升数据分析能力
  • 优化生产流程,提升生产效率
  • 提升生产管理效率
  • 提高生产计划的准确性

2. 供应链管理与优化

在制造业中,供应链管理是企业运营的重要环节。关系型数据库通过提供高效的数据存储和查询能力,支持制造企业对供应链数据的管理和分析。例如,通过对供应商信息、采购记录、库存数据等的分析,制造企业可以优化供应链管理流程,降低采购成本。

关系型数据库支持对供应商信息、采购记录、库存数据等数据的存储和管理。通过SQL查询,制造企业可以快速获取供应商的历史合作记录和采购信息,进行供应商评估和选择。例如,通过对供应商的采购历史进行分析,制造企业可以识别出高质量的供应商,建立长期合作关系。

在供应链管理方面,关系型数据库还可以与其他数据分析工具结合使用,进行更为深入的供应链分析和优化。例如,通过与FineDataLink的结合,制造企业可以实现对多源数据的实时同步和分析,提升供应链管理的精准性和时效性。

  • 提供数据支持,优化供应链管理流程
  • 降低采购成本,提高供应链效率
  • 结合数据分析工具,提升供应链分析准确性

关系型数据库在制造业中的应用,不仅提升了生产流程管理的效率,还支持了供应链管理和优化。通过有效的数据管理和分析,制造企业可以提高业务运营效率,增强市场竞争力。

📚 结论

关系型数据库在不同领域中的应用展示了其强大的数据管理能力和广泛的适应性。通过结构化的数据存储、高效的查询能力和可靠的事务管理,关系型数据库为企业的数字化转型提供了有力支持。无论是在金融、医疗、零售还是制造业,关系型数据库都在推动企业提升业务运营效率、优化决策流程和增强市场竞争力。随着技术的发展和企业需求的不断变化,关系型数据库的应用场景还将不断拓展,为各行业创造更多的价值。

来源:

  1. Connolly, T., & Begg, C. (2014). Database Systems: A Practical Approach to Design, Implementation, and Management. Pearson.
  2. Elmasri, R., & Navathe, S. B. (2015). Fundamentals of Database Systems. Pearson.
  3. Date, C. J. (2004). An Introduction to Database Systems. Addison-Wesley.

    本文相关FAQs

🧐 关系型数据库在企业中有哪些基础应用场景?

老板要求我们在企业数字化转型时选择合适的数据库技术。关系型数据库是大家常提的方案,但具体在企业中它能用于哪些基础应用场景呢?有没有大佬能分享一下自己的经验?


关系型数据库在企业中的应用场景多种多样,主要的基础应用包括客户关系管理(CRM)、企业资源管理(ERP)、财务管理等。这些系统的核心需求是稳定、高效的数据存储和查询能力。关系型数据库以其结构化的数据模型、支持事务处理和复杂查询的能力,成为这些系统的首选。

客户关系管理(CRM)系统通常需要存储大量的客户信息,包括姓名、联系方式、购买历史等。这些信息之间存在复杂的关系,例如客户与订单的关联、客户与服务记录的关联等。关系型数据库通过表与表之间的连接,可以轻松实现这些数据的查询和管理。

探索性数据分析

企业资源管理(ERP)系统涉及库存、生产、物流、销售等多个模块。关系型数据库的事务处理能力确保每个模块的数据一致性和完整性。例如,在库存管理中,关系型数据库可以确保库存数量的准确更新,避免多用户同时操作时的数据冲突。

财务管理系统需要处理大量的账目和交易数据。关系型数据库的强大查询能力支持财务人员快速生成报表,进行数据分析。这些系统通常需要复杂的查询和报表生成能力,关系型数据库的SQL语言便于实现这些功能。

🚀 如何在大数据场景下优化关系型数据库的性能?

我们公司正在扩展业务,数据量越来越大,传统的关系型数据库性能开始下降。有没有办法在大数据场景下优化关系型数据库的性能呢?求大神指点!


在大数据场景下,关系型数据库的性能优化是企业面临的常见挑战。随着数据量的增长,查询速度和系统响应时间可能会降低。以下是几种优化策略:

  1. 索引优化:创建合适的索引可以显著提高查询速度。索引类似书籍的目录,可以帮助数据库快速定位需要的数据。然而,过多的索引可能导致写入性能下降,因此需要平衡查询和写入性能。
  2. 分区表:对于超大规模的数据集,分区表将数据分成多个独立的部分,可以提高查询效率。例如,按日期分区可以使查询特定日期的数据更加快速。
  3. 缓存使用:在数据库层或应用层使用缓存,减少对数据库的直接查询请求,从而提高响应速度。Redis等内存数据库可以作为缓存解决方案。
  4. 垂直和水平拆分:垂直拆分是将不同类型的数据分布到不同的服务器上,水平拆分是将同一类型的数据分布到多个服务器上。这两种策略可以有效分散负载,提高系统性能。
  5. FineDataLink的应用:如果企业在数据集成上遇到困难,可以考虑使用像FineDataLink这样的平台。它支持对数据源进行单表、多表、整库、多对一的数据实时全量和增量同步,简化数据集成过程,提高性能。 FineDataLink体验Demo

通过这些策略,可以在大数据场景下有效优化关系型数据库的性能,满足企业的增长需求。

🤔 关系型数据库如何支持实时数据同步?

我们公司正在实施实时数据分析,但关系型数据库的同步速度有限。有没有办法提高关系型数据库的实时数据同步能力?大家都怎么解决这个问题?


关系型数据库的实时数据同步是现代企业进行实时数据分析的关键问题。传统的批量同步和定时更新方式在面对实时数据需求时表现出明显的不足。以下是提高实时数据同步能力的几种方法:

  1. 复制技术:数据库复制技术允许在多个数据库实例之间同步数据。主从复制、双向复制等技术可以确保数据的实时更新。通过配置复制规则,可以实现数据的实时同步。
  2. 数据流处理:使用流处理技术如Apache Kafka,可以实现实时数据的捕获和传输。Kafka可以作为数据流的中间层,将实时数据传输至数据库。
  3. 事件驱动架构:采用事件驱动架构可以支持实时数据同步。通过监听数据库写入事件,实时更新目标数据源。例如,通过使用触发器或日志捕获技术,可以实现实时数据同步。
  4. 优化网络延迟:实时同步的关键在于减少网络延迟。选择低延迟的网络传输协议和优化网络配置可以提高数据同步效率。
  5. 数据集成平台:使用专业的数据集成平台如FineDataLink,可以简化实时数据同步的过程。FDL支持实时同步任务配置,确保在数据量大或表结构规范的情况下实现高性能的实时数据同步。

通过这些方法,可以显著提高关系型数据库的实时数据同步能力,满足企业实时数据分析的需求。选择合适的技术和工具是解决问题的关键。

【AI声明】本文内容通过大模型匹配关键字智能生成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。

帆软软件深耕数字行业,能够基于强大的底层数据仓库与数据集成技术,为企业梳理指标体系,建立全面、便捷、直观的经营、财务、绩效、风险和监管一体化的报表系统与数据分析平台,并为各业务部门人员及领导提供PC端、移动端等可视化大屏查看方式,有效提高工作效率与需求响应速度。若想了解更多产品信息,您可以访问下方链接,或点击组件,快速获得免费的产品试用、同行业标杆案例,以及帆软为您企业量身定制的企业数字化建设解决方案。

评论区

暂无评论
电话咨询图标电话咨询icon产品激活iconicon在线咨询